B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, specially formulated for feed-quality use and tested to fulfill stringent quality and basic safety specifications. BHT is usually a lipophilic organic and natural compound that may be mostly utilised being an antioxidant in a variety of industrial applications. In animal diet, BHT FEED GRADE TEST is commonly utilized to forestall the oxidation of fats and oils in animal feed, thereby preserving the nutritional benefit and lengthening the shelf life of the feed. Oxidized fats not only reduce nutritional efficacy but might also make damaging compounds, affecting the health and fitness and expansion of livestock. The inclusion of BHT in feed needs rigorous screening to make sure it adheres to regulatory expectations and it is Safe and sound for consumption by animals, which inevitably enters the human food items chain. The testing protocols commonly assess the purity, efficacy, and likely residues in animal tissues.
An additional vital compound inside the chemical area is Pentachloropyridine. This compound is often a chlorinated derivative of pyridine and has garnered fascination as a result of its utility as an intermediate in the synthesis of agrochemicals, dyes, and prescription drugs. Its high degree of chlorination causes it to be a potent compound, which ought to be handled with care as a result of prospective toxicity and environmental considerations. Pentachloropyridine serves like a building block in chemical synthesis, enabling chemists to create more complex molecules that may be Utilized in herbicides, insecticides, as well as specialty polymers. The dealing with and disposal of Pentachloropyridine are regulated, provided its potential environmental persistence and bioaccumulation danger. Industries dealing with this compound generally adopt shut-technique production strategies and rigorous protection protocols to reduce exposure.
M-Phenylene Diamine, typically abbreviated as MPD, is really an aromatic amine that attributes prominently inside the production of aramid fibers, which are properly-noted for their warmth resistance and power. Kevlar and Nomex, Utilized in physique armor and hearth-resistant outfits, respectively, are developed applying MPD as being a essential precursor. The compound alone is made of a benzene ring with two amino teams during the meta positions, making it ideal for making polymers with appealing thermal and mechanical Qualities. M-Phenylene Diamine (MPD) is additionally Utilized in the dye marketplace, especially in hair dyes and various beauty programs, Despite the fact that its use continues to be curtailed in a few areas on account of safety problems. When manufacturing products and solutions that contains MPD, good occupational basic safety practices are essential to secure personnel from extended exposure, which could lead on to skin sensitization or other health concerns.
O-Phenylene Diamine (OPDA), even though structurally much like MPD, differs while in the positioning from the amino groups, which significantly influences its chemical reactivity and software. OPDA is frequently utilized during the production of dyes and pigments, wherever it contributes towards the development of vivid hues which can be secure and extensive-lasting. It is also Employed in the synthesis of heterocyclic compounds and prescription drugs. OPDA’s function in corrosion inhibitors and rubber chemical substances more highlights its versatility. Even so, just like other aromatic amines, OPDA is likewise affiliated with toxicity risks, and so, its use is carefully managed and monitored. The value of accurate dealing with, proper storage, and satisfactory protective steps can't be overstated when handling OPDA in any industrial location.
Pinacolone is yet another noteworthy compound with a range of programs. It's a ketone with the molecular components C6H12O which is utilised mainly being an intermediate while in the synthesis of pesticides and herbicides, specifically in the manufacture of triazole fungicides and specific plant growth regulators. Pinacolone’s framework includes a tertiary butyl group, which contributes to its unique reactivity in organic and natural synthesis. Past agriculture, it will also be found in the manufacture of prescribed drugs and fragrances. Pinacolone is valued for its ability to bear nucleophilic substitution and condensation reactions, making it a worthwhile reagent in laboratory and industrial procedures. Although it is actually significantly less harmful than a few of the Earlier discussed compounds, security safeguards remain necessary to mitigate any hazards affiliated with its volatility and possible irritant Houses.
two-Heptanone is really a ketone that In a natural way takes place in certain crops and can also be found in modest portions in human sweat and selected animal secretions. It is usually Employed in the fragrance and taste industries because of its nice, fruity odor. Furthermore, 2-Heptanone has located apps for a solvent and intermediate in natural and organic synthesis. Apparently, investigate has prompt that it may well Participate in a job in chemical signaling, significantly in insects, where by it functions being an alarm pheromone. This has resulted in its examine in pest Handle techniques and behavioral science. Industrially, 2-Heptanone is synthesized to be used in coatings, adhesives, and cleaners. Its rather small toxicity makes it well suited for use in purchaser products and solutions, While correct labeling and managing Guidance are usually mandated.
